Herd Manager

WM FarmHerd ManagerMultiple farms, Canterbury2d ago
**Job Description** **Feed Production Management** • Assist with any feed planning or the management of as appropriate. • Assist to manage weeds and pests to maintain pasture and crops. **Milking** • Ensure the effective operation of all aspects of the milking process, including plant hygiene and somatic cell count, to maintain grade free standards. **Effluent** • Operate and maintain the effluent system on your farm to all regional council compliance requirements and the employer’s additional standards. • Maintain all appropriate effluent management records. • Know what to do when things go wrong. **Animals** • Implement animal health program to maintain good health. • Assist with calving and the calf rearing program to achieve minimal losses and ensure high quality replacements are available for the herd. • Ensure all herd records are maintained. **Business** • Work with the Dairy Farm Manager to contribute to Farm Business Plan. • Assist to manage repairs and maintenance schedule for all plant, machinery and infrastructure. • Ensure all relevant company policies are understood and adhered to. • A minimum of 12 months New Zealand Dairy farming Experience required. **Farm Size (ha)**: 320 **Peak Herd Size (cows)**: 1200 **Typical On-farm Staff**: 5 **Accommodation available**: SHARED ACCOMMODATION **Average Hours Per week**: 40 **Roster**: Double rotation - 5 Days on / 2 days Off - 6 Days on / 1 day Off **Remuneration paid by**: By Negotiation
